Пример API тестов для сервиса https://test-api-market.herokuapp.com/swagger-ui/index.html#
Пример тестов, которые можно реализовать для тестирования службы REST API, предоставляющей интерфейс CRUD операций
Метод POST /api/caterogy Добавление категории
Метод DETELE /api/caterogy/{categoryId} Удаление категории по id
Метод PATCH /api/caterogy/{categoryId} Изменение категории по id
Метод POST /api/product Добавление товара
Метод GET /api/product/{productId} Получение товара по id
Метод DELETE /api/product/{productId} Удаление товара по id
Метод PATCH /api/product/{productId} Изменение товара по id
Метод GET /api/products Получение списка товаров
- Склонировать репозиторий, выполнив команду в терминале
git clone git@github.com:ivan-strelka/testTaskBlancBank.git - Перейти в директорию с проектом, выполнив команду в терминале
cd testTaskBlancBank - Запустить прогон тестов, выполнив команду в терминале
gradle clean api --stacktrace --info - Запустить скачивание отчёта Allure, выполнив команду в терминале
gradle downloadAllure - Запустить загрузку отчёта Allure, выполнив команду в терминале
gradle allureServe - Наслаждайтесь результатами тестового прогона :)


